  • Radical formation reaction of phenolic antioxidants were examined MO theoretically. Results show that substitution of electron-donating alkyl groups in phenol increases the rate of phenoxy radical formation when attacked by an electrophilic radical by stabilization of cationic transition state.

  • The synthesis of new 5-benzyl-4-cyanomethyl-2-methylpyrimidine derivatives (5) containing chloro, methoxy, ethoxy, phenoxy and anilino groups at 6-position on the pyrimidine ring were prepared from 5-benzyl-4-chloro-2-methylpyrimidine derivatives (3) and tert-butylcyanoacetate. The derivatives of 5-benzyl-4-chloro-2-methylpyrimidine (3) containing chloro, methoxy, ethoxy, isopropoxy, phenoxy and anilino groups at 6-position on the pyrimidine ring were prepared from 5-benzyl-4,6-dichloro-2-methylpyrimidine (2).

  • The analysis of trace herbicides using the on-line SPE-HPLC system and a photochemical reaction was studied. 18 compounds of herbicides including eight triazines, six phenoxy acids and esters, and four other herbicides were examined. The on-line SPE-HPLC system developed for selection of eluting solvent improved chromatographic efficiency. The recoveries of herbicides were higher than 77%. With 100 mL tap water samples, the detection limits for all analytes were in the 0.1-2.3×10-10 M range. Detection was done by a UV or fluorescence spectrometer after photochemical reaction at the end of the column with 2W or 450W mercury lamp. Without a photochemical reaction, all compounds responded to 230 nm UV detector, but phenoxy acids and esters were weakly detected. However, with a photochemical reaction, these compounds were selectively detected at 320 nm wavelength of UV absorption and 400 nm emission of the fluorescence detectors. This method can be used for the analysis of environmental water containing herbicides at trace levels.

  • A series of new liquid crystalline compounds having two identical mesogenic terminal units, the 4-(p-nitrobenzoyloxy)phenoxy group, attached to both ends of a central polymethylene spacer of various lengths was prepared. The mesomorphic properties of the compounds were investigated by differential scanning calorimetry (DSC) and by polarizing microscopy. Almost all of the compounds formed monotropic nematic mesophases. The trimethylene spacer compound was found to be non-liquid crystalline, while the one with the hexamethylene central spacer was enantiotropic. A thermodynamic analysis was performed for the phase transitions of the compounds and the results are discussed in relation to their liquid crystal properties.
